WebPage 2 of 12 Member Protection Policy -Part A Code of Behaviour To display respect and courtesy towards everyone involved in netball and prevent discrimination and harassment. To prioritise the safety and well-being of children and young people involved in netball. To encourage and support opportunities for participation in all aspects of netball. Webwhich is a member of Netball NSW. Child (Young Person) means a person under 18 years of age. Individual Member (Member) means a natural person who is a registered financial member of Netball NSW or an Affiliate. Member Protection Policy (MPP) means the Netball NSW Member Protection Policy as amended from time to time.
